Call to Artists + Poets - "Arts as Vision"

Portland-based nonprofit Springboard Innovation is requesting visual art and poetry proposals for their "Art as Vision" Social Innovation Forum Art Exhibit. This community oriented art exhibit is open to all ages and skill levels.

What is your vision for the future? Create an artistic rendering of your hope for the future of Portland, the world, your neighborhood, etc....This could mean anything from a aerial painting of Portland roofs covered in solar panels and plants to a poem about a world without war.

The "Art as Vision" art exhibit runs January 14 - Feb 9 at Urban Grind East. If you are interested in participating, email katherine@springboardinnovation.org

Zenger Farm Education Volunteer Training

Zenger Farm Education volunteers are essential to our experiential education programs and service-learning projects. Zenger Farm field trips provide visitors with opportunities to learn about sustainable farming practices, healthy soils, botany, and wetland ecology.

At our two day volunteer training we will provide information on how to lead outdoor experiential education programs, discuss the fine art of behavior management and add depth and understanding to local flora and fauna and sustainable farming.

The two-day training is offered:

Wednesdays: February 11th and 18th, 9:30am-12:30pm -OR- Thursdays February 12th and 19th, 9:30am to 12:30pm
